Luma AI Launches Ray3: World's First Reasoning Video Model for Studio-Grade HDR Content

By

Ankit Sharma

26d ago· 1 min readenProduct

Summary

Luma AI's Ray3 is presented as the world's first reasoning video model that generates studio-grade HDR content. It features a reasoning engine that combines visual and language processing, draft mode for rapid iteration, advanced physics and scene consistency, visual annotations for directing motion, and native HDR support. The technology enables users to create photorealistic 3D renders and video content using their phones, positioning it as accessible VFX technology for everyone.
